Eucerin Aquaphor Repair Ointment provides dry to very dry, rough and irritated skin with the emergency care it needs.

Features:

  • This ointment, without water, forms a semi-permeable protective barrier over the skin that supports the natural passage of water vapor into and out of the skin, allowing it to “breathe” and reinforcing its natural protective function.
  • The ointment is enriched with Glycerin and Panthenol. Glycerin is an effective moisturizer that attracts water and helps keep it inside the skin. It works in conjunction with Panthenol, which helps to speed up skin regeneration and repair while keeping it hydrated.
  • Without perfumes, it is clinically and dermatologically proven as a repair agent for very dry, rough or irritated skin.
  • This soothing and transparent ointment is easy to use and you only need to apply it by massaging gently to penetrate the problematic areas of the skin, such as the knees and elbows, cracked toes and cuticles and cracked heels.
  • It is composed of only a few ingredients, being well tolerated by sensitive skin and suitable for use in babies and children, as well as minor burns and skin subjected to superficial dermatological interventions, such as laser treatments and chemical peels.
  • The skin is regenerated, protected and repaired.
  • It should only be used on re-epithelized skin (that is, after new tissue has formed) and never on open, wet or bleeding wounds. Check with your dermatologist about the amount of time you should wait after a treatment before you can use the product.

Directions for use:

Apply whenever necessary to the affected areas. A very small amount is usually sufficient for both hands. A small amount of ointment is almost perfect for problem areas of babies' skin, and a slightly larger amount is ideal for each foot. Massage the product until it penetrates the skin using your fingertips. The ointment spreads easily as it warms up. Do not use the ointment on open, moist or bleeding wounds.
